02:18This is a picture of me and Ray.
02:44We're still smiling in this picture, so.
02:48It just makes me remember that there were good times.
02:55We had so much fun in the beginning.
02:57We spent a lot of time together and we hung out and played games.
03:01In the beginning, it was just a lot of fun then.
03:05I don't know, I just feel stupid saying there were good times.
03:08Like, how could there have been good times?
03:11But, I mean, there were.
03:14I think from the very moment I met him, he was playing a role.
03:21Looking at this picture, if I could go back, I would tell that girl to run as far away from that man as she could.
03:29The day that I met Ray, I mean, living in Ohio, and I have my house with my two kids.
03:44I was pretty kind of lost and broken and just searching, I guess, for myself or something.
03:59I was single.
04:00I had just gotten out of a relationship and I didn't know who I was anymore.
04:06I really didn't feel like I had a purpose in life.
04:09I just was kind of existing and floating through life.
04:15Meeting Ray was completely random.
04:18A mutual friend of ours had a gathering at her house and I had one over there.
04:23He was nice and funny and he seemed caring and he seemed like he was attentive and just, he seemed like a nice guy.
04:31I don't think I've ever really laughed so much with anybody.
04:35I didn't want to stop talking to him.
04:37I didn't want him to go home.
04:39I was kind of opening up to him about what was going on in my life.
04:44And he said he'd be there and kind of helped get me through it and just kind of seemed like a very, very caring person.
04:50And that made me want to get to know him more and spend more time with him.
04:54I did not realize that I was literally giving him everything that he was going to use against me on a silver platter.
05:01Maybe it's because you're so lost.
05:03They seem so perfect.
05:04I don't know.
05:05I thought I was opening up and actually connecting with someone.
05:09I didn't, I didn't know who he was going to turn out to be.
05:20Pretty early on, I knew that he had been previously married, but he had been divorced for a long time.
05:31We were pretty much together almost every day.
05:34We would go fishing and go walk and hang out in the parks, go out to the bars and have drinks.
05:39One night, Ray and I were out at the bar drinking and then all of a sudden, Ray opened up a little bit about his past to me.
05:46There's something I got to tell you.
05:48Ann told me that he had a kidnapping charge that he had spent some time in jail for.
05:54After he said that, I really didn't know what to believe.
05:57It's something I'm not proud of.
05:59I was, I think, still in like just shock and my heart sank.
06:04He told me that his ex-wife was dating somebody new and that person had hit their child, one of their sons.
06:11So he went over there to fight the person and drug him out of the house and beat him up.
06:17So he told me that he got a kidnapping charge for dragging the guy out of the house.
06:23Not the best thing, but in my mind, it was okay.
06:29I guess you're defending your kid.
06:30I mean, not the best way to do it, but okay.
06:33I understand maybe I wouldn't go to that extreme too, but you're sticking up for your kid and it was a long time ago, so I'm not going to judge you on something that you were honest with me about.
06:45But I think that should have been my warning sign.
06:48I wish I would have known the full story.
06:52I really wish I would have asked more questions.
06:54I wish I would have been not so trusting.
06:58Later on, his ex-wife contacted me and we've talked and I do know what the real story is.
07:03He actually kidnapped her and took her to a cemetery, drug her around by her hair and told her to pick out her own grave.
07:26We had gone to a birthday party and there was a guy that came on a motorcycle.
07:33I love motorcycles.
07:35My parents have motorcycles.
07:36I grew up around them.
07:37It had been a long time since I had taken a ride on a bike, so I was pretty excited about it.
07:45I asked him to take me for a ride around the block on his motorcycle.
07:49Would you mind?
07:50Not at all.
07:51Okay.
07:52Ray actually was standing right there when I asked.
07:55There you go.
07:56And apparently that was not the correct thing to do.
08:00Kind of didn't look happy, but he didn't like immediately yell at me or anything like that.
08:05He just kind of was a little sulky and then I just all of a sudden noticed that he was gone.
08:11At first I just thought, I'm like, okay, he got mad about something.
08:16So I didn't, yeah, I didn't think it was that big of a deal.
08:19Then I realized he actually left me at that party and I had to get a taxi home.
08:26I mean, I guess I should have thought he left me there, but I was just, I really honestly didn't know why.
08:34I'm like, okay, what's going on?
08:36Let me go home and find out what's going on.
08:40When I got home, he told me how disrespectful that was.
08:48That I should never, ever disrespect him like that again.
08:52That no man was going to take his lady out on a bike.
08:55And then Ray got very, very upset.
08:57You thought you were slick?
08:58It was just a motorcycle ride.
09:00And we get into an argument and he just all of a sudden came at me from behind.
09:04Had my shoulders pinned down.
09:08And remembering the look on his face, how mad and angry he was.
09:14It was scary and shocking, like this whole other side of him that I had not ever seen before.
09:24He was punching me in the face.
09:26I remember asking him to stop, you know, telling him to stop hitting me.
09:34But then I finally got away.
09:36I ran down to my neighbor's house.
09:39They came down to help me, but he had taken off.
09:42And the neighbors wanted to call the police, but I didn't let them and I did not call the police.
09:47At that time I was just, I didn't, I was embarrassed.
09:51I was confused and I really still at that time was struggling with, that's not really him.
09:57And then Ray began sending me messages, apologizing and promising to change and be a better person.
10:03He even encouraged me to call the cops on him.
10:06He told me that I should call the cops on him because he deserved to be in trouble for what he did.
10:11And I told him, no, I'm not going to do that to you because at the time I saw it as remorse, not manipulation.
10:20But that's how good of a manipulator he is.
10:25Like I thought maybe, you know, that was just a one time thing.
10:29People have bad nights and do stupid things when they're drinking.
10:32So I fully did believe that it was not going to happen again.
10:36I wish I knew then what I know now.
